Sparse rhubarb

I have a rhubarb crop that has remained somewhat sparse. There are multiple small sections of 4-5 stalks. How do I get the sections to grow larger?

Marianne's Response

Sounds like your rhubarb needs to be divided and then pampered with a good dose of manure and fertilizer. Add a thick mulch of composted manure to the soil around the plants now. This will help the soil to stay cool and moist over the summer. Then, in the spring, you can divide the clump into smaller sections and replant each new start into soil that has been improved with compost and manure. Spring is also the time to fertilize with a slow-release plant food like Osmocote. I expect you'll be making lots of rhubarb pies soon after. Keep growing, Marianne Binetti
